President has announced that the conflict mediation process led by the Asantehene, , and which has started, would bring lasting peace to Bawku soon.

Speaking at the graduation parade of the Ghana Military Academy on Friday, April 11, 2025, the president described the situation in the area as a major security threat and stressed the need for all key stakeholders to collaborate to restore peace. "We have triggered the Otumfuo mediation process, which saw all stakeholders participate in discussions in Kumasi on a roadmap towards peace.

I'm assured by the Asantehene that the process will resume next week when he returns from his brief visit abroad. "We need the cooperation of all to restore peace at Bawku and its environs and I entreat all sides to embrace peace as we dialogue to resolve this age-old dispute.

Only two days ago, an incident in the marketplace triggered an unfortunate loss of lives and criminal vandalism of properties.
